R 是一种用于统计计算和图形的语言和运行环境。它包括一个广泛的功能集合,用于统计计算和图形,以及用于数据分析和科学研究的各种工具。R 是自由和开源的,可以在多种平台上运行,包括 Windows、Mac OS 和 Linux。

R 语言的特点包括:

1. 强大的数据分析和图形功能:R 语言提供了大量的函数和库,用于数据分析、统计建模和图形展示。这使得 R 成为数据科学家和统计学家进行数据分析和可视化的首选工具。

2. 开源和自由:R 是自由和开源的,这意味着任何人都可以免费使用它,并可以根据自己的需求对其进行修改和扩展。这促进了 R 社区的繁荣,许多开发者贡献了大量的包和工具,使 R 的功能更加丰富。

3. 灵活和可扩展:R 语言具有高度的可扩展性,可以通过编写自己的函数和包来扩展其功能。这使得 R 能够适应各种不同的应用场景,从简单的数据分析到复杂的数据挖掘和机器学习任务。

4. 丰富的社区支持:R 拥有一个庞大的用户社区,包括数据科学家、统计学家、研究人员和开发者。这个社区提供了大量的教程、文档、论坛和会议,帮助用户学习和使用 R。

5. 与其他语言的集成:R 可以与其他编程语言,如 Python、C 和 Java 集成,这使得 R 可以与其他语言的优势相结合,以解决更复杂的问题。

总之,R 是一种功能强大、灵活且易于使用的编程语言,特别适合于数据分析和统计计算。它的开源和自由特性,以及强大的社区支持,使其成为数据科学家和统计学家的重要工具。

R编程语言:数据分析与统计建模的强大工具

随着大数据时代的到来,数据分析与统计建模在各个领域都扮演着越来越重要的角色。R编程语言作为一种免费、开源的统计软件环境,凭借其强大的数据处理能力、丰富的统计分析函数库以及灵活的可视化功能,成为了数据分析与统计建模领域的首选工具。本文将详细介绍R编程语言的特点、安装方法以及常用操作指令,帮助读者快速上手R语言进行数据分析与统计建模。

一、R编程语言的特点

1. 免费开源:R语言是免费、开源的,用户可以自由下载、安装和使用,无需支付任何费用。

2. 丰富的函数库:R语言拥有丰富的数据处理、统计分析、机器学习、深度学习等函数库,满足不同领域的需求。

3. 灵活的可视化功能:R语言提供了多种可视化工具,如ggplot2、lattice等,可以生成高质量的图表和可视化结果。

4. 强大的数据处理能力:R语言支持多种数据格式,如CSV、Excel、SQL数据库等,可以方便地进行数据清洗、转换和整合。

5. 强大的扩展性:R语言可以通过安装各种包和插件来扩展其功能,满足不同领域的需求。

二、R编程语言的安装方法

1. 访问CRAN(The Comprehensive R Archive Network)官网下载R语言安装包。

2. 根据操作系统选择合适的安装包版本,如Windows用户可下载R-4.4.1 for Windows。

3. 运行安装程序,按照默认设置进行安装。

4. 安装完成后,在系统环境变量中添加R语言的安装路径。

5. 安装RStudio:访问RStudio官网下载RStudio安装包,按照默认设置进行安装。

三、R编程语言常用操作指令

1. 数据导入

(1)导入CSV文件:

data <- read.csv(\